I started wearing glasses when I was in third grade and spent the next 30+ years with impaired…read morevision, settling into a -5.5 prescription in both eyes. Bad enough that I couldn't, say, recognize faces or drive a car without glasses or contacts. I was used to waking up with blurry vision and putting in my one-a-days, sometimes after several hours of loafing around in glasses, looking obviously ungroomed at school drop-off. But I was always curious about Lasik, and planned to get it whenever I knew I was done being pregnant. I finally got into it a few months ago and found Dr. Paul Lee and CCRS on, of all places, our very own Yelp.com (there are a lot more reviews of the Hancock Park office, but as I only went there for consults and had my procedure done here, this is where I'll leave my review). I messaged CCRS through its website and heard back almost immediately. I was able to set up a complimentary consultation less than two weeks later (and was in fact offered a time the following week), at the Hancock Park location right by my house. Unfortunately, Dr. Lee doesn't operate at that office, as it's smaller and less thoroughly equipped, but he's there a couple times a week and I've been able to schedule all of my follow-ups there, except for the one the day after my surgery. I was immediately impressed with Dr. Lee. He is an expert in his field, thoroughly knowledgeable and professional, with a kind, reassuring demeanor. He's done thousands of refractive surgeries, and you can just tell by talking to him that he knows what he's doing. I knew nothing about any of these procedures except for Lasik, and he walked me through the other options, methodically laying out the pros and cons of each one. After examining my eyes, he determined I was a good candidate for ICL, a procedure that doesn't involve altering the cornea, like Lasik. In stupid terms, I'd say ICL is like having permanent contact lenses. They're inserted in a short surgery, and they can be removed at a later date. I'd always assumed I'd need glasses again when my eyes changed in old age, but with ICL, I can actually just get new lenses. To my surprise, I was able to book the surgery itself the following week, and only delayed by another week because I needed a weekend when I could go without contact lenses in preparation for the procedure. There was a required prep appointment, but I was able to do it on the same day as the surgery. I was told to plan on being at the office for about five hours, and was done in three and a half. There was a lot of examination and numbing, much irrigating of the eyes with various liquids. Some of this was uncomfortable, and I learned the hard way that tear ducts drain directly into the back of the throat (the worst side effect of my ICL surgery was actually a lingering cough from the battery of drops). But the surgery was as fast and painless as promised, Dr. Lee narrating while I had my eyes clamped open a la Clockwork Orange. I wouldn't do it again for fun, but the whole experience was on par with an involved trip to the dentist, and they gave me Valium. My eyes were sensitive and I didn't want to open them for the rest of the day, but they didn't hurt, and I passed out super early (I think this was the Valium). I woke up the next morning with no discomfort and miraculously clear vision. I drove myself to the follow-up appointment, and other than a few nights of sleeping with goggles and a couple weeks of eyedrops, I was basically done with treatment. It's been a couple months, and the ICL has been life changing. I could not be happier with the results, and have been evangelizing the procedure to all of my friends. If you're considering refractive surgery, make an appointment with Dr. Lee and CCRS. I'm honestly mad that I waited as long as I did.

So, I took about year to select CCRS and take the plunge for cataract surgery. They have great…read morereviews, but I think I was concerned about surgery in general. Eventually, I decided to go to them for an office visit in their Pasadena location. This is an incredibly nice facility. And the staff are excellent and available. It is the "new" type of medical practice, where the facility and the staff are more akin to a spa than a traditional office. This threw me a little, because I'm like "I know who is paying for all this: me." So I was definitely skeptical when I got to the "let's look at your options" portion of the visit. But first, you get the examinations. Plural. As in at least 3 different examinations at the first visit. The exams seem both comprehensive and useful. They do old school eye tests and new fangled ones. Since I already had a cataract diagnosis, I know they nailed the exams and the conclusions. It was the most extensive set of exams I'd ever had on my eyes, and I liked that. This gets you to the "options" part of the visit. The kind staff escort you into a clear walled office with a tv screen showing options for your malady. They inform you of the possible types of cataract lenses, and ask your general preference. Then Doctor Lee comes in and -- at least for me -- basically says you should really only look at the most expensive ones: Light Adjustable Lenses in my case. Let me first say that he was absolutely right. LAL lenses are amazing. But the whole approach felt very salesy. Not used car salesy, but definitely "upsell" salesy. This was especially true because it was in this separate office with an associate coming in first, then the "lead." The practice exactly mirrors what new car dealerships do. In retrospect, I think that Dr. Lee was so certain in his presentation because he knew -- from a lot of experience -- that LAL lenses were the best option for me. For whatever reason, it did not land well with me. I'm glad I got over it and made the appointment for the surgery. I had the surgery done at the same Pasadena office. They are really efficient there, with Dr. Lee seeing patients on regular visits the same day that he will do your surgery. They obviously planned the office out well and, in return, make good returns on their investment. But the price for my surgery was excellent compared to other providers; I just think Dr. Lee has optimized the process. Good for him. I definitely felt attended to during the pre-surgery and surgery itself. One recommendation: take whatever drugs they offer before the surgery. I turned them down because I wanted to drive home myself after the surgery. That was a mistake. The surgery didn't hurt or anything, but I was worried throughout that I would move or flinch and ruin the process. I think the drugs would have solved that problem. In all events, the surgery went well. Actually, the result was amazing. I always had decent vision, but post surgery it was like the world was in 3D. I had no post-operative issues, and my eyesight is amazing. I really appreciate CCRS's clean, beautiful, and well-staffed facilities. I really recommend them without reservation.

Predatory financial practices at the billing desk. Proceed with extreme caution…read more I am leaving a 1-star review strictly due to the deceptive financing tactics used by the front desk staff. My mother came to this clinic for eye surgery, and the staff took it upon themselves to sign my parents up for an $11,000 medical credit card (Alphaeon / Comenity Bank) without properly explaining the actual terms. My parents have limited English proficiency, and the clinic staff took full advantage of that language barrier. They pushed the financing as a simple, helpful payment plan, completely failing to explicitly warn them that it was a "deferred interest" credit line. Because of how the clinic aggressively pushed this paperwork, my family was blindsided by massive retroactive interest penalties, and the bank eventually attempted an automated withdrawal of nearly $6,000 from my parents' checking account, forcing us to involve federal regulators to get our money back. My warning to other patients: Do not let the staff here apply for any financing, loans, or payment plans on your behalf. If you have elderly parents or family members who are not fluent in English, do not let them speak to the billing department alone. Read every single sentence of the financial paperwork before you sign anything.
